Product Description
3M™ Water Contact Indicator Tape 5557NP quickly shows indication when
contacted by water. When water comes in contact with the tape surface, it rapidly
changes from white to red.
The tape is designed to withstand heat and humidity
aging without giving false indication. It will continue to show indication even after
prolonged submersion in water. The adhesive is a high performance acrylic
protected by a silicone coated film release liner.

General Information
• Tape may be die cut using rotary die cutting process.
• Substrate should be smooth, clean, dry and oil-free to insure good wet-out and
adequate adhesion.
• Adhesive should not be applied at temperatures <50°F (10°C) (best if room
temperature or higher).
• Not useful for indicating contact with other non-aqueous liquids such as oils and
organic solvents.
• Standard roll size = 12" x 180 yards (304.8 mm x 165 m).
Application Ideas
• As a water contact indicator in handheld or portable electronic devices such as cell
phones, PDA’s, pagers, MP3 players, game players, CD players, cordless phones,
two-way radios, laptops, digital or film cameras, video cameras, etc.
• As a water contact indicator for other products with sensitivity to aqueous liquids.

Shelf Life
To obtain best performance, use this product within 12 months from date of
manufacture and store under normal conditions of 60° to 80°F (16° to 27°C) and
40 to 60% R.H. in the original carton.
